Paras vastaus
Hei,
Sekvenssikaavioita käytetään mallinnamaan logiikan kulku sisällä järjestelmä näyttämällä tiedot (joita kutsutaan myös ärsykkeiksi tai viesteiksi), jotka välitetään objektien välillä skenaarion suorittamisen aikana. Se on eräänlainen vuorovaikutuskaavio, joka kuvaa kuinka ja missä järjestyksessä objektiryhmä (käyttöliittymäkomponentit tai ohjelmistokomponentit) on vuorovaikutuksessa toistensa kanssa. Järjestyskaaviot tunnetaan myös tapahtumakaavioina.
Järjestyskaaviot voidaan luoda käyttämällä:
- Lucidchart – Voidaan käyttää luomaan erilaisia UML-kaavioita, kuten sekvenssikaavio, käyttötapauskaavio, tilastokaavio, toimintakaavio jne.
- StarUML – voi käyttää luomaan erilaisia UML-kaavioita, kuten sekvenssikaavio, käyttötapauskaavio, tilastokaavio, toimintakaavio jne.
- Sequencediagram.org
- Seuraavat kaaviot
- Visual Paradigm Online (VP Online) Express Edition
- Creately – ilmaisella versiolla on rajoituksia
Voit ottaa yhteyttä minuun saadaksesi lisätietoja yksityiskohdat [email protected]
Vastaa
Olen testannut erilaisia ilmaisia ohjelmistoja piirtääksesi kaavioita ja myös joitain muut UML-kaaviot (lähinnä aktiivisuus- ja tilakaaviot ams)
Suosikkini on plantUML ( http://plantuml.com ). Se on tekstipohjainen työkalu, joka tuottaa laadukkaita piirustuksia. Tekstipohjaisen version edut ovat:
- erittäin tehokas kaavion muokkaamiseen, käytän sitä jopa kokousten tai verkkokokousten aikana piirtämään ja keskustelemaan ratkaisusta suorana.
- Lähdeteksti voidaan tallentaa muiden asiakirjojen kanssa versiotyökaluun, kuten Git, jatkokäsittelyä varten.